About Greta West
Greta West is a small rural locality in north-east Victoria, situated approximately 236 kilometres north-east of Melbourne and around 24 kilometres south-west of Wangaratta, within the Rural City of Wangaratta local government area. With a population of 157 at the 2021 census, the locality is sparsely settled and characterised by open pastoral land, grazed properties, and the picturesque foothills of the Victorian Alps. Its postcode is shared with the adjacent locality of Greta, and the two communities together form part of the historic Kelly Country region.
Greta West carries historical significance as Ned Kelly, Australia's most famous bushranger, is known to have lived in the area for a period, and the surrounding landscape of creeks, rivers, bushland, and mountains echoes the pioneering era. The township was settled in the 1890s, with a post office operating from 1892 until 1994. Residents rely on nearby Glenrowan and Moyhu for basic amenities, while Wangaratta — about a 30-minute drive away — provides a full range of shops, schools, medical services, and rail connections to Melbourne.
Greta West falls under postcode 3675 and is governed by the Wangaratta Council (Local Government Area). For federal elections, residents vote in the electorate of Nicholls, while state elections fall under the Ovens Valley (Northern Victoria) electorate.
